Update on the hurdles...they just ran qualifying....

Felicien ( :canada1 ) qualified 2nd in her heat, 0.01 behind 1st. Got off to a slow start (and complained afterwards of a very fast gun - a number of the other competitors also complained of this). By hurdle 6 or 7 she was clearly in the lead...then coasted knowing she had qualified.

American Gail Devers is OUT! Fell before reaching the first hurdle. She had a leg injury going into the race, and they were saying she really shouldn't have been out there. She was expected to be Felicien's main competition. So good news from a betting standpoint.

16 move on to the semi's, slated for tomorrow around 12:30pm EDT. Then the finals go Tuesday around 1:30pm EDT.

Women's hurdles semifinal heat #1, just run minutes ago...

Felicien wins in a time of 12.49 seconds, .04 ahead of 2nd place... .05 off her seasonal best... and 0.1 seconds off the world record. Much better start and overall form today than yesterday. The gun is still fast but the competitors are adapting to it.

Post-race interview she says she "definitely has a lot more" in the tank. She says she didn't really feel she was in a rhythm until hurdle #5. If that's true it sure wasn't noticeable to me. She was in the lead the whole way and looked just great today.

Looking good. Onward...big race is tomorrow!

(edit)

Joanna Hayes (USA) wins 2nd heat in 12.48. Second-best time in the world this year. A second Canadian, Angela Whyte, also eeks her way into the final 8, running a 12.69, her personal best. :canada1 Woohoo!

Felicien crashes into the first hurdle, takes a big spill...and wipes out the woman in the lane next to her at the same time. They're actually debating re-running the race now for the sake of the Russian woman who was knocked out of the race through no fault of her own. Assuming they don't do that however...Hayes of the US is the winner...in an Olympic-record time of 12.37. :eek: That's INSANELY fast. If I'm not mistaken Felicien's personal best was 12.46? Hayes personal best going in was 12.48. And she shaves 0.12 off of it?? I wonder if that was a clean run? :rolleyes:

So regardless...I don't think Perdita was going to put up that kind of a time anyways. I've never seen her do anything like this before.
